Relabelling starts with an approved correction
Product relabelling or repacking is the right response when saleable stock can be brought back into an approved condition without changing the product itself. The physical work may involve label-over application, label removal and replacement, barcode correction, supplementary information, new inserts or a complete secondary-pack change.
The decision to rework stock must come before production starts. The brand owner, sponsor or regulatory adviser defines the approved correction, affected stock and release conditions. A production provider then applies that instruction consistently, records exceptions and returns evidence that the work matched the brief. If the compliant label content is still being decided, the job is not ready for the production floor.

When relabelling or repacking is the right response
Relabelling is most useful when the stock remains physically sound and the problem can be corrected through approved packaging information or presentation. Repacking becomes appropriate when the pack format itself is damaged, obsolete or unsuitable for the intended market.
- Market-entry correction. Imported stock needs approved local information, warnings, language, distributor details or identifiers before release.
- Regulatory or artwork change. Existing stock carries a superseded label and the responsible product owner has approved a correction path.
- Retailer requirement. Barcodes, tickets, pack configuration or shelf-ready presentation must change for a specific channel.
- Recall or market action. A regulator-approved strategy allows affected stock to be corrected and returned to supply rather than destroyed.
- Packaging recovery. The product is suitable for sale but cartons, inserts, labels or secondary packs need replacement after damage or a specification change.
Decide the disposition before touching stock
A controlled rework job starts with a written disposition: release without change, inspect, segregate, relabel, repack, quarantine, return or destroy. That decision must identify who can approve the correction and who can release the finished stock. Production teams should not infer either from an email thread or an outdated artwork file. For Australian therapeutic goods, the TGA's current Procedure for recalls, product alerts and product corrections uses a five-step market-action process, reduced from the previous 10 steps. Its published timeframes include a target of seven business days for agreeing to a complete notification and automatic publication to the DRAC two business days after agreement. Immediate-risk situations follow a different path and can require the sponsor to contact the TGA promptly within 48 hours. The figures below are regulatory process points, not a production timetable. The TGA can vary requirements case by case and incomplete material can delay review. For other product categories and countries, the decision path will differ. The same production principle still holds: define the affected batches, approved artwork, correction method, inspection rule and release authority before stock moves out of quarantine.
| TGA process point | Published figure | What it means operationally |
|---|---|---|
| PRAC process | 5 steps, reduced from 10 | Assessment, notification, initiation and closeout should be planned as one controlled process |
| Immediate-risk notification | Contact the TGA promptly within 48 hours | Urgent quarantine and customer protection may begin before the standard review path |
| TGA review target | Within 7 business days for complete notifications | Incomplete or unclear evidence can extend the approval window |
| DRAC publication | 2 business days after agreement | Summary details become publicly searchable shortly after the action is agreed |
| Progress reporting | Typically 6 weeks and 12 weeks | Production records and reconciliations must support interim and closeout reporting |
Build a rework brief that cannot be misread
A good brief removes judgement from the application bench. It tells each person what stock is in scope, what correct looks like and what must happen when something does not match.
- Stock scope. Record SKUs, batches, lot numbers, serial ranges, quantities and current locations.
- Approved source files. Identify the artwork version, approval date and owner. Withdraw superseded files from the production pack.
- Application standard. Show exact placement, orientation, overlap, legibility, adhesion and acceptable finish using approved reference images.
- Product matching. Define how workers distinguish similar SKUs, markets, flavours, sizes or pack variants before applying a label.
- Barcode and identifier checks. Confirm the approved data and whether the proposed change affects the trade item identifier under the GS1 GTIN Management Standard.
- Inspection rule. State whether every unit needs verification or whether an approved sampling plan applies. Define who can accept an exception.
- Handling controls. Include storage, hygiene, security, temperature, breakage and segregation requirements relevant to the product.
- Release evidence. Specify the counts, photographs, scan results, reconciliation and approvals required before dispatch.
Choose the correction method deliberately
The fastest method is not always the safest one. The right choice depends on the approved disposition, pack surface, label position, product category and evidence required at release.
| Correction method | Best fit | Main control point |
|---|---|---|
| Label-over application | The existing label may remain and the approved correction can fully cover the relevant content | Opacity, adhesion, placement and continued readability of information that must remain visible |
| Remove and replace | The old label must not remain or the finished presentation requires a clean surface | Product or pack damage during removal, residue control and correct replacement variant |
| Supplementary label | Approved information can be added without changing the main label | The new label must not obscure required information or create conflicting instructions |
| Barcode or ticket correction | The product data or retail channel requires a new approved identifier or ticket | Scan verification against the product master and destination allocation |
| Secondary repack | The product is suitable but the carton, insert, bundle or presentation pack must change | Component completeness, product protection, pack version and final configuration |
Run the work in controlled batches
Production should move through a repeatable sequence: receive and quarantine the stock, reconcile it to the approved scope, set up one confirmed reference unit, apply the correction, verify the output, isolate exceptions and reconcile finished quantities before release. A controlled relabelling workflow makes each handoff visible instead of relying on a final inspection to catch everything.
The highest risk is usually variant confusion. Similar packs may need different labels for market, SKU, batch or product version. Separate work zones, one active artwork version, visible reference units and clear changeover rules reduce that risk. Verification should check both the physical finish and the match between product, label and destination.

Regulated products need an extra licence check
For regulated products, confirm whether the proposed work is itself a regulated manufacturing step and whether the chosen facility is authorised for that exact activity. Do this before transport is booked.
In Australia, the TGA states that manufacture of medicines and other therapeutic goods can include packaging and labelling. For listed medicines, its licensing decision guidance identifies packaging and labelling as mandatory manufacturing steps and places responsibility on the sponsor to use manufacturers with the appropriate licence or clearance. Medical devices follow a different manufacturer and conformity-assessment framework, so a medicine licence should not be treated as a general medical-device approval.
Australia's medical-device Unique Device Identification requirements are also being phased in. The TGA confirms that UDI labelling became mandatory for Class III and Class IIb devices on 1 July 2026, with later dates for other device classes. Its UDI guidance explains the applicable dates and the responsibility to maintain device data in the AusUDID.
These examples show why a production provider should not decide regulatory content. The sponsor, manufacturer or qualified adviser confirms the obligation and approved correction. The provider confirms that its facility, process and records can execute that instruction. This article is operational guidance, not regulatory or legal advice.
What evidence should return with the stock
A completed quantity is not enough. The release pack should let the brand owner confirm what was received, what was changed, what passed inspection and what happened to every exception.
| Evidence | What it should confirm | Why it matters |
|---|---|---|
| Inbound reconciliation | Received quantity by SKU, batch, lot or serial range | Establishes the controlled population before work begins |
| Artwork and instruction record | The approved version used for the production run | Prevents superseded labels or instructions being used |
| Inspection record | Checks completed, results, exceptions and corrective action | Shows whether the finished stock met the agreed standard |
| Quantity reconciliation | Good units, rejected units, damaged units and unused labels | Closes gaps that could hide a mix-up or stock loss |
| Release approval | The authorised person who accepted the finished output | Separates production completion from regulatory or commercial release |
| Dispatch evidence | Destination, quantity, date and stock identity | Maintains traceability as corrected stock returns to distribution |
